Broncos React to Offseason Workouts on Twitter

ENGLEWOOD, Colo. --With construction on the Broncos' headquarters humming along in the background, construction of the 2014 team took its first step at Dove Valley on Monday.

For the first time this offseason, players were able to participate in voluntary organized workouts at the team's facility as part of phase one of the Broncos' voluntary offseason conditioning program kicked off.
